Possibly, my longest experiment ever. Don’t misunderstand me, I never treated it as one, as my intentions were always very clear and in no way unlike any other person’s, who decides to hire a dating agency. Nevertheless, the aspect of wanting to understand how dating agencies work from the customer standpoint, and whether they are more or maybe less viable alternatives to online dating, is just as true. This was something I always wanted to understand.

Does the famous Hitch actually exist, is there any science behind matchmaking, or is it nothing more than a well-marketed “analogue” variant of the myriad apps single people like myself use, to find love and companionship?

I spent roughly one year as the customer of a fairly well-known Irish matchmaking agency. The name is not relevant, nor are the names of the ladies I have been introduced to.
